Frequently Asked Questions About Flooring Installers in Gatewood

Get answers to common questions about flooring installers services in Gatewood, Missouri.

1What is the typical cost range for professional flooring installation in Gatewood, and what factors influence the price?

In the Gatewood and broader Missouri area, professional installation typically ranges from $3 to $12 per square foot, heavily dependent on material choice and subfloor preparation. For example, laminate or vinyl plank is on the lower end, while hardwood or intricate tile work is higher. Key local cost factors include the age of your home (affecting subfloor leveling needs), material delivery fees to our rural area, and the contractor's travel distance within Ripley County.

2How does Missouri's humid climate affect my choice of flooring and its installation?

Gatewood's humid summers and variable seasonal temperatures make moisture management critical. We strongly recommend acclimating solid hardwood or laminate flooring inside your home for 3-5 days before installation to prevent warping or gapping. For basements or ground-level installations, moisture-resistant options like luxury vinyl plank (LVP) or tile are often safer choices due to potential ground moisture, which is common in our region.

3Are there specific times of year that are better or worse for scheduling flooring installation in Gatewood?

Late spring through early fall is generally ideal due to moderate temperatures and lower humidity, allowing for proper material acclimation and adhesive curing. We advise against scheduling major installations during the peak of summer humidity or deep winter, as extreme conditions can complicate the process. However, professional installers in our area are experienced in managing Missouri's seasons with climate-controlled practices year-round.

4What should I look for when choosing a reliable flooring installer in the Gatewood area?

Prioritize local, licensed, and insured contractors with verifiable references in Ripley County or nearby communities like Doniphan. A reputable installer will always conduct an in-home assessment to check subfloor conditions and discuss moisture barriers, which are vital for our climate. Be wary of quotes given solely over the phone without a site visit, as older homes in our area often have unique subfloor challenges that affect the project scope.

5Do I need a permit for flooring installation in my Gatewood home, and are there other local regulations?

For standard residential flooring replacement, permits are generally not required in Gatewood or Ripley County. However, if the project is part of a larger remodel involving structural changes to the subfloor, it's best to check with the Ripley County Building Department. The primary local consideration is proper disposal of old materials; many reputable installers will include haul-away services, coordinating with the local waste management guidelines.
